Released in 1993, The Italian Contract is a music, romance and comedy film directed by Vladislav Chebotarev, running about 89 minutes.

What it’s about. The Italians, conquered by the Tatar singer's skill, offer him a contract. By the will of circumstances, Renat gets first to Yalta and only then on the yacht of a drug dealer to Italy. Here the hero finds himself in prison, meets an Italian beauty and is carried away in a hot air balloon...

Who’s in it. The Italian Contract stars Renat Ibragimov, Olga Kabo, Leonid Bronevoy and Sergey Gazarov, among others.
